The corporate return form for Maryland is known as Form 500. Businesses use this form to report their income, deductions, and calculate their tax liability owed to the state. Accurate completion of Form 500 ensures compliance and helps maintain your business reputation. Receiving a letter from the Comptroller of the Maryland Compliance Division typically indicates that there is an issue with your tax filings. This may include discrepancies, missing documentation, or a request for clarification regarding your submitted forms. It’s important to address such communications promptly to avoid further penalties.
